Position Purpose: Under the direct supervision of a certified staff member, to assist certified professional staff with helping students meet instructional goals and objectives or to assist with other duties in the school that add to the overall quality of the school or the educational experience of the students. Experience working with students with aggressive behavior utilizing behavior management techniques is required. PMT certification is preferred.
Essential Job Functions:
1. Assist and guide students to reinforce reading, language arts, mathematics, computer instruction, and other skills.
2. Work with students individually and in small groups to reinforce basic learning and implement assigned programs.
3. Assist professional staff in the administration and correction of classroom exercises, tests, and assessments.
4. Assist in classroom preparations and strategies for reinforcing instructional materials and skills according to individual student needs.
5. Assist with record-keeping procedures to document student learning and performance.
6. Help control behavioral and emotional outbursts by employing techniques such as reward systems, behavior checklists, and time-outs.
7. Supervise students in non-instructional areas, such as lunch programs, bus duty, playground, corridors, study halls, and other related areas.
8. Accompany students on field trips to assist with supervision.
9. Assist students with special needs in all aspects of classroom instruction to maximize inclusion, learning, and achievement of IEP objectives.
10. Contribute to the IEP process as appropriate and serve as a resource for the evaluation team.
11. Assist students with physical or mental disabilities with activities of daily living to maximize their participation in school or learning activities.
12. Follow all safety rules, procedures, and regulations governing assistance for all students, including those with disabilities or other special needs.
13. Experience working with students with aggressive behavior utilizing behavior management techniques is a must.

Qualifications Profile: Candidates must meet one of the following:
1. High school diploma plus two years of college credit
2. Associate of Arts degree
3. Passing score on the ParaPro Assessment
